I was boosting
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"I was boosting"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used in contexts where someone is referring to enhancing, increasing, or promoting something, often in a casual or informal manner. Example: "During the meeting, I was boosting our team's morale by sharing positive feedback and encouraging everyone to contribute their ideas."

FAQs
What can I say instead of "I was boosting"?
You can use alternatives like "I was enhancing", "I was promoting", or "I was improving" depending on the context.
How to use "I was boosting" in a sentence?
Use "I was boosting" to describe a past action where you were actively improving or promoting something. For example, "I was boosting team morale during the project."
Is "I was boosting" appropriate for formal writing?
No, "I was boosting" is generally considered informal. For formal writing, use alternatives like "I was enhancing" or "I was promoting".
What's the difference between "I was boosting" and "I was helping"?
"I was boosting" implies a direct effort to increase or improve something, while "I was helping" is a more general term for providing assistance. Boosting suggests a more active and impactful role.
